压力诱导的格雷夫斯病:在缓解压力后自发恢复

概括
仅仅减轻压力可以导致格雷夫斯病 (GD) 的缓解. 在一项对11名患有压力诱导性关节疾病的患者的研究中,9名患者在没有药物治疗的情况下实现了缓解,这表明治疗方法可能发生变化.

背景情况:
- 情绪压力是格雷夫斯病 (GD) 的已知触发因素之一.
- 压力减轻对GD结果的影响在很大程度上仍未被探索.
研究的目的:
- 为了研究缓解压力的有效性,作为压力诱导的格雷夫斯病的独立治疗方法.
- 评估在没有抗甲状腺药物的情况下管理压力的GD患者的缓解率和持续时间.
主要方法:
- 11名被诊断患有压力诱导的GD的患者的回顾性病例系列.
- 患者拒绝抗甲状腺药物治疗,并专注于自我报告的缓解压力.
- 对临床和生化参数 (TSH,FT4,TRAb) 进行了监测.
主要成果:
- 在11名患者中,有9名患者在缓解压力的1-7个月内实现了临床和生化缓解.
- 五名患者经历了长期缓解 (平均随访时间为2.3年).
- 较高的基线FT4和TRAb水平与缓解的可能性较低有关.
结论:
- 仅仅减轻压力就能在很大一部分患有压力诱导的胃炎的患者中引起缓解.
- 这一发现表明,在这些患者中,可能需要重新考虑抗甲状腺药物治疗的持续时间或必要性.
- 临床医生可能会考虑压力管理作为压力诱导的GD的主要干预措施.

Hypothalamic-Pituitary Axis
60.1K
The response to stress—be it physical or psychological, acute or chronic—involves activation of the Hypothalamic-Pituitary-Adrenal (HPA) axis. The HPA axis is part of the neuroendocrine system because it involves both neuronal and hormonal communication. Its function is to regulate homeostatic systems—metabolic, cardiovascular, and immune—providing the necessary means to respond to a stressor.
